Don't Take Part in Vote for Pope, Abuse Victims Tell Cardinal

By James Bone
The Times UNITED KINGDOM
February 20, 2013

http://www.thetimes.co.uk/tto/faith/article3694202.ece?CMP=OTH-gnws-standard-2013_02_20


The Primate of All Ireland has been dragged into the growing uproar over cardinals who are accused of covering up sex abuse in the Roman Catholic Church and yet will be voting to choose the new pope next month. Victims of abuse have demanded that Cardinal Seán Brady, the Archbishop of Armagh and the head of the Catholic church in the Republic of Ireland and Northern Ireland, does not go to the conclave to elect Pope Benedict XVI’s successor.
